Output 39513404fb6b70406c51cf49e13b4ef73c5b118874229d1b63397c125c9e55ac:3

value
40690622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a23ccfa96a2df3412e6d1ed04f786c446665f87 OP_EQUALVERIFY OP_CHECKSIG
address
LWMmb6KLymfzTZ4nKPSqHb85573Wcqbry6
transaction
39513404fb6b70406c51cf49e13b4ef73c5b118874229d1b63397c125c9e55ac
spent
true